Building a Fanbase That Lasts: 7 Moves Every Artist Should Make

Streams come and go. Fans stay. Ask Wizkid FC. If you want to last in this game, you need people who ride with you long-term. Here’s how to build them:

  1. Engage → Reply to comments and DMs. That “he noticed me!” feeling is priceless.

  2. Own a Story → Every great artist has a story: Wiz = Starboy, Burna = African Giant. What’s yours? Push it till it sticks.

  3. Exclusive Drops → Use WhatsApp groups, Telegram, or private SoundCloud links to make your fans feel special.

  4. Collabs → Don’t just chase Davido. Work with fellow upcomers. Shared fanbases = growth.

  5. Consistency → You don’t need 10 tracks a week. But steady drops and content keep you alive in people’s minds.

  6. Offline Grind → Campus shows, open mics, street events. Online hype fades, but live memories stick.

  7. Merch Moments → Even small. Branded tees, caps, stickers. Fans love to “rep” you.

  Remember, Clout is temporary. A fanbase is forever.
